Author: Kiki C.
Food 4/5 - we have to admit it's great value, $19.99 may be the best deal to satisfy our sushi cravings, especially it's AYCE. I am not looking for high-end omakase quality when I come here. We try to order rolls with less fried fillers. Since we passed teenage/college age already and can't have AYCE very frequently, we keep track of what we order/what we like/what we don't like to avoid (repeated) trial error. I also suggest to keep a digital copy of what you mark on the menu/order sheet, in case they may miss somethingl when they get super busy. Service - 4/5 the waitresses we have had are generally nice and prompt. They serve water and kitchen food relatively quickly, and it's easy to get their attention when you want to order more. Sometimes sushi may take awhile to be ready, but it's made to order, I would manage my expectations when they get busy. Ambiance - 4/5 the store is spacious and can accommodate different sizes of parties. I never seen it been used but they have private rooms as well. Takeout - we ordered the sushi tray a few times for parties. Place order online to receive 20% off.
